Apr 07, 2020 android tutorial android development course beginners, android programming training, android development tutorials for beginners, android programming tutorials for beginners pdf free download,how to. And check out these other resources to learn android development. It is used by over 100k developers and is a good alternative of sqlite in this tutorial i will teach you how to use realm database in android. This tutorial will teach you basic android programming and will also take you through some advance concepts related to android application development. Mar 19, 2019 android comes in with built in sqlite database implementation. This tutorial will give you a quick start with sqlite and make you comfortable with sqlite programming. Operations such as create, read, update and delete crud in android is an essential skill every aspiring android developer must have. If you want to do all the crud operations insert, update, delete, display with multiple tables, then visit sqlite with multiple tables android. For start i dont need anything fancy, just to make a login and register screens and want to connect that to sqlite database. This tutorial has been prepared for the beginners to help them understand basic android programming. Sqlite is embedded relational database management system. On windows download the android backup extractor jar found on sourceforge here, then run java jar abe. Android sql databases sql databases using sqlite 1. This example demonstrate about how to use unicode in android sqlite.
However, if you are planning to develop android applications which rely upon sqlite databases, you will need to install the tools necessary for android development, such as the android sdk and the eclipse ide. To learn android sqlite database, it is good we know the various data storage media which are owned by the android. But for newbies who have just started applying sqlite for android development, this db and its complex massive structure feels like a real headache. Nightly builds often fix bugs reported after the last release. Before starting this tutorial, you should read and perform the following tutorial session. It is in this tutorials tab, users would find the theoretical aspect about the android application development and learn about the basic concepts of android.
Android java tutorial app designed for beginners, expertise on android. So, there is no need to perform any database setup or administration task. A method of structuring data as tables associated to each other by shared attributes. This is a step by step android crud tutorial where well create an android application that demonstrates android s sqlite database capabilities. Android sqlite database tutorial using android studio. Pada tutorial pemrograman android ini, untuk membuat databasenya kita akan menggunakan bantuan library greendao. Download sqlite offline installer setup 64bit for windows pc. Clp is a command line application that let you access the sqlite database management system and all the features of the sqlite. Android tutorial sqlite android android app development. By the end of this tutorial, you should feel comfortable creating an android. The documents listed in the left navigation teach you how to build android apps using apis in the android framework and other libraries.
In the next post, i will provide a similar introduction to content provider and in the last part of the series, i will show how to use android sqlite and content provider to build a note taking app. For many applications, sqlite is the apps backbone whether its used directly or via some thirdparty wrapper. It follows a tutorial based approch in which you iteratively create android applications to learn the base concepts. In order to access this database, you dont need to establish any kind of connections for it like jdbc, odbc etc. Tutorials for android and java free download and software. Sqlite crash course for android developers learn how to. Android sqlite database tutorial, sqlite query, insert, sqlitedatabase, put, delete. This book covers the basic and advanced topics with equivalent simplicity and detail, in order to enable readers to quickly grasp and implement the concepts to build an application database. It starts from introduction to android till covering. May, 2018 we are going to create a simple notes app with sqlite as database storage. The sample database file is zip format, therefore, you need to extract it to a folder, for example, c. With these easy tutorials, you will learn all the techniques needed to create mobile applications.
Embarcadero technologies 6 every firemonkey component can have an owner, a parent, and children. The code for the software is in the public domain and is thus free for use for any purpose, commercial or private. I want to download mysql database data to sqlite database and then, the android application using this sqlite database information. Every device has an inbuilt support for sqlite database, which is automatically managed on android right from its creation, execution to querying up process. Using livebindings to populate a listview ios and android this tutorial describes the basic steps to use sqlite as a local data storage on.
In this tutorial, we assume that you have some understanding of relational databases, in theory, but require a bit of a refresher course before you. Android tutorial step by step learning android sqlite. First, we will discuss data storage in android briefly and then focus on android sqlite database. Here, we are going to see the example of sqlite to store. This sqlite 3 tutorial addresses all of sqlites major features.
Here we will see how to use sqlite database as a storage system in android to perform crud operations. In this tutorial, we discuss how to create sqlite database in android with an example of an employee management system. Apr 05, 2015 this android sqlite database tutorial for beginners developing android apps optional sqlite tutorial i will show step by step how to insert, create, update, delete, select data from sqlite using. Go to sqlite download page, and download precompiled binaries from windows section. In this post, we will cover the following contents. The source code for sqlite is in the public domain. Room provides an abstraction layer over sqlite to allow fluent database access while harnessing the full power of sqlite. It is ideal for both beginners and professionals who wants to learn or brush up the basics of android. Android sqlite tutorial with example in android studio. Whenever an application needs to store large amount of data then using sqlite is more preferable than other repository system like sharedpreferences or saving data in files. Android sqlite tutorial with examples of activity and intent, fragments, menu. Android sqlite database tutorial, android tutorial for beginners learn android programming and how to develop android mobile phone and ipad applications starting from environment setup. Seegatesite today i will share an article about android tutorial step by step learning android sqlite database for beginner. Note if for any reason the standard windows release does not work e.
Learn programming for android easy and free learning to program mobile applications for android. Sqlite implements most of the sql92 standard for sql. Is there any way to download mysql database information to sqlite. Nov 20, 2015 android sqlite for beginners in this post, i will cover the fundamentals of android sqlite from a beginners perspective. Im new to android development and creating a simple android application which interacts with the web server. Generally, in our android applications shared preferences, internal storage and external storage. Android sqlite is the mostly preferred way to store data for android applications. Now lets start by creating new project in android studio. If you dont have zip software installed, you can download a free zip software such as 7zip. The complete android application development coursework great in 2020. Our sqlite tutorial is designed for beginners and professionals both. Our each tutorial will contain at least 1 example and free code to download which you can easily import in android studio. This article is about android sqlite database tutorial.
The complete android application development coursework. Sqlite sample database and its diagram in pdf format. Realm is an open source database that can be used to store data locally in android. My name is sandip and ill be leading you through the course. If you want to do all the crud operations insert, update, delete, display with multiple tables, then. To know more about sqlite, check this sqlite tutorial with examples. Download any sqlite browser plugins or tool in my case db browser for sqlite. Android sqlite essentials focuses on the core concepts behind building databasedriven applications. Apps that handle nontrivial amounts of structured data can benefit greatly from persisting that data locally. Sqlite is an open source light weight relational database management system rdbms to perform database operations, such as storing, updating, retrieving data from database.
This tutorial for android is mainly divided into three sections. Sqlite is a structure query base database, open source, light weight, no network access and standalone database. Write sqlite data access object dao class for handling database create, read, update and delete crud operations on the table. Sqlite tutorial with example in android studio step by.
Android realm database tutorial the crazy programmer. Using clp, you can create and manage the sqlite database. Sqlite is the most widely deployed sql database engine in the world. Developers can also inspect and modify databases on a given android emulator or device using the sqlite3 commandline tool provided as part of the android sdk tool called android debug bridge adb. The focus of this tutorial will be on data persistence in android using sqlite. Jun 29, 2017 this android studio tutorial video will help you learn the basics of android app development.
Sqlite provides various tools for working across platforms e. Is it possible to do that are there any tutorials for that. Learn android database tutorials with example in android. If the database is stored on the sdcard you can browse the data, change records and query the data. Udemy android sqlite programming for beginners free. Sqlite 64bit download 2020 latest for windows 10, 8, 7. Sqlite tutorial provides basic and advanced concepts of sqlite. Introduction on android sqlite database the android sqlite database requires very little memory around 250kb, which is available on all android devices. In android sqlite database is used to store and perform insert, update. This page assumes that you are familiar with sql databases in general and helps you get started with sqlite databases on android.
Sqlite is a inprocess library that implements a selfcontained, serverless, zeroconfiguration, transactional sql database engine. There are several storage options available in android like shared preferences, internal and external storage, sqlite, etc. To download sqlite, you open the download page of the sqlite official website. Add an action bar menu item icon to insert employee details into database. We will discuss performing create, read, update and delete operation in the android sqlite db. Save data in a local database using room android developers.
On linux you can follow the dd instructions from the answer i gave credit to in the beginning. Below is the final app we will create today using android sqlite database. It is now a valuable resource for people who want to make the most of their mobile devices, from customizing the look and feel to adding new functionality. This tutorial describes how to create android applications.
It has partial support for triggers and allows most complex queries. If you are completely new to android development, you will benefit from my other introductory tutorials to android development. Library greendao ini adalah library buatan dari greenrobot, nah daripada bingung saya akan mengkutip istilah greendao ini itu apa. Thats why the new solution which isnt based on sql at all and is very simple to work with created a huge hype in the programming sphere when it was released in 2017.
And it is the tool that we will use throughout the tutorial. The app will be very minimal and will have only one screen to manage the notes. A helper class to manage database creation and version management. Android sqlite database tutorial the crazy programmer. Sqlite tutorial website helps you master sqlite quickly and easily. Jan 20, 2016 seegatesite today i will share an article about android tutorial step by step learning android sqlite database for beginner.
Tutorials for android and java app this android java tutorial app was a completely free app which was in the offline mode. Dec 01, 2018 well be using db browser for sqlite software as sqlite editor sqlite manager. This android tutorial provides a complete guide for learning android application development. Android sqlite tutorial with example in android studio step. The app is designed in a way that even a layman who has no prior knowledge of android but has some basic knowledge of java can learn android app development and become a professional developer with advance level concepts and tutorials. This android sqlite tutorial explains the following, how to create a new database with a table employee table in your application. The highlighted download package is called the commandline program clp.
Android sqlite database sqlite is a opensource sql database that stores data to a text file on a device. Download sqlite database browser from sourceforge here, then open the db file contained within. Android sqlite database tutorial android app development. And when we talk about android so sqlite is that default feature which is used as a database and also used as a local database for any application. Sqlite supports all the relational database features. Sqlite 64bit is an inprocess library that implements a selfcontained, serverless, zeroconfiguration, transactional sql database engine. It explains the complex concepts in simple and easytounderstand ways so that you can both understand sqlite fast and know how to apply it in your software development work more effectively. Android is an operating system based on the linux kernel. Most applications require a medium for storing information inside. First, use the command line program and navigate to the sqlite directory where the sqlite3. May 08, 2020 a full packed android app development tutorials app with examples and explanations for you to take a step forward in your career. Android is developed in the android open source project aosp. Android sqlite tutorial for beginners is available with source code to download.
This android sqlite tutorial will cover the simple operation of sqlite databases like insert and display data. Contribute to stockrtsqlite3android development by creating an account on github. Android sqlite database example tutorial journaldev. If youre brand new to android and want to jump into code, start with the build your first app tutorial. It is selfcontained, serverless, zero configuration and transactional sql database engine. This will be an advance category for android developer where we share tutorial on android database such as sqlite, internal. To benefit from this tutorial, it would be ideal that you have covered some fundamentals of android development. Android studio tutorial for beginners 1 android tutorial. Android comes in with built in sqlite database implementation.
926 867 770 1568 942 1046 213 154 1424 1493 234 258 443 652 649 1407 875 261 1101 691 606 1474 343 780 1129 1483 127 1372 1298 357 906 950 885 1299 317 569 582 597 308 649 690 1200 191 350 128 878